Closed Bug 1047706 Opened 6 years ago Closed 5 years ago

Stop returning a full error page

Categories

(Marketplace Graveyard :: Consumer Pages, defect, P4)

2014-Q2
x86
macOS
defect

Tracking

(Not tracked)

RESOLVED WONTFIX

People

(Reporter: andy+bugzilla, Unassigned)

References

Details

(Whiteboard: [repoman][marketplace-transition])

We will no longer need to return error pages in zamboni with any template. Just returning a 404, 403 or 500 status code is enough and maybe a string.

This can apply to zamboni and webpay etc.
I'm confused. You're saying that https://marketplace.firefox.com/developers/asdfasdf should just return a 404 status code with a string?
Assignee: nobody → delza
Assignee: delza → jeroentulp
Assignee: jeroentulp → nobody
Priority: -- → P4
Whiteboard: [repoman]
This would seem to be at odds with bug 972495, so I'm going to NI andy for more explanation.
Flags: needinfo?(amckay)
If the 404, 500 and other error pages are static pages (as they should be) returned by nginx, then there is no need for zamboni, webpay, stats and every other service in the marketplace cluster to return a custom 404.

They just return a 403, 404, 500 error code as appropriate and in nginx they are mapped to a static page. This change is to change those services to not return a full page and delete the content from those repos.
Flags: needinfo?(amckay)
Status: NEW → RESOLVED
Closed: 5 years ago
Resolution: --- → WONTFIX
Whiteboard: [repoman] → [repoman][marketplace-transition]
You need to log in before you can comment on or make changes to this bug.